Read moreAstronomical Center Rijeka is a great site for something more than regular tourism. It was renewed in 2009 on the base of WW2 fort. It contains a telescope, an observation deck, a planetarium and a caffe bar. Thematic presentations are held in the planetarium throughout the week. The view from the deck is astonishing and there are chairs and tables so one can just sit there enjoying the drink...
